The National Institute of Technology Rourkela (NIT Rourkela) has released an official notification for the recruitment of 19 Junior Research Fellow (JRF) posts on a temporary/contractual basis. This is a great opportunity for candidates with B.E./B.Tech, M.E./M.Tech, M.Sc., or MCA degrees who have qualified through GATE or other national-level eligibility tests. Interested candidates must submit their applications to the respective Principal Investigators before the deadline.

Eligibility Criteria
Essential Qualification (For all posts)
- Post Graduate degree in basic science OR Graduate / Post Graduate Degree in Professional Course selected through a process described through any one of the following national eligibility mechanisms.
- Scholars selected through National Eligibility Tests such as CSIR-UGC NET including Lectureship (Assistant Professorship) and GATE.
- Selection through National Eligibility Examinations conducted by Central Government Departments and their Agencies and Institutions such as DBT, DST, DAE, DOS, DRDO, MoE, ICAR, ICMR, IIT, IISc, IISER, NISER etc.

Salary / Stipend
- Year 1 and Year 2: Rs. 37,000.00 per month.
- Year 3 onwards: Rs. 42,000.00 per month (till completion of project).
Age Limit
Maximum age limit is 30 years.

Selection Process
Selection will be based on an Interview. The interview will be conducted in Hybrid mode. Online mode is possible on request, however, offline interview is preferred. Department-wise interview location is mentioned in Annexure-I.
